高速公路改擴建路基加寬不均勻沉降的演化及規(guī)律研究

  本文選題:改擴建 切入點:不均勻沉降 出處:《石家莊鐵道大學》2015年碩士論文 論文類型:學位論文


【摘要】:隨著我國的經(jīng)濟騰飛,高速公路建設的規(guī)模與速度都處在一個相當快的發(fā)展階段,在目前已處于運營階段的的高速公路中,由于設計時對我國近些年飛速發(fā)展的交通狀況估計不足,有相當大比例的高速公路是雙向四車道。隨著交通流量日漸增大,這些根據(jù)當時的預計交通流量所設計的高速公路已經(jīng)明顯無法滿足目前的交通需求,然而在土地資源日益緊張的時代,在保留既有線路的同時,重新選線修筑新的高速公路并不是一個完美的方案,而對既有的高速公路進行加寬、改建、擴建成為了相對更合理的方案:高速公路改擴建所需占地情況相較新建高速公路節(jié)省了大量寶貴的土地資源;在改擴建工程中可以保持部分線路不斷交施工,能夠在維持現(xiàn)階段的交通通過量的同時進行施工。沉降是高速公路地基處理及路基填筑質(zhì)量檢測的重要指標之一,沉降監(jiān)測是最直觀了解高速公路沉降情況的方式。改擴建工程中新老路基間不均勻的差異沉降量的大小直接關系到在工程完工通車后道路的使用是否能夠達到要求,過大的沉降差會導致路面開裂,甚至路基失穩(wěn)塌陷,所以對改擴建工程進行沉降監(jiān)測工作以進行施工控制是非常必要的。本文針對加寬路基中地基固結程度不同產(chǎn)生的不均勻沉降與路基壓縮程度不同產(chǎn)生的不均勻沉降機理分別進行了理論研究,根據(jù)工程情況對本項目改擴建工程新加寬路基的沉降控制標準做了一些有意義的研究。根據(jù)施工中實測所得數(shù)據(jù)與有限元模擬計算所得數(shù)據(jù)進行校核分析,從實際工程中對所選擇的控制標準與控制方法進行驗證。在得到不同工況不同施工時期的沉降數(shù)據(jù)后,可以通過數(shù)學的方法對沉降監(jiān)測中所得到的實測數(shù)據(jù)進行相應的數(shù)據(jù)擬合,推算出未來一個時期內(nèi)路基沉降量的變化趨勢,通過擬合得到的曲線圖預測出后期沉降變化,可以通過預測所得的結果對未來的施工采取相應合理的施工控制措施,以保證加寬路基的施工質(zhì)量。
[Abstract]:With the rapid development of our country's economy, the scale and speed of highway construction are in a rather rapid stage of development. Due to the lack of estimation of the traffic situation in recent years, a large proportion of freeways are two-way four-lane. As the traffic flow increases day by day, These highways, designed on the basis of the projected traffic flow at the time, are clearly unable to meet current traffic needs, but in an era of increasing land scarcity, while retaining existing lines, Rerouting to build new highways is not a perfect plan, but widening and reconstructing existing highways, The expansion has become a relatively more reasonable plan: the need for freeway reconstruction and extension saves a great deal of valuable land resources compared with the newly built expressway, and part of the lines can be maintained for continuous construction in the reconstruction and extension projects. The settlement is one of the important indexes of the expressway foundation treatment and subgrade filling quality detection. Settlement monitoring is the most intuitive way to understand the settlement of expressway. The uneven differential settlement between new and old subgrade in the reconstruction and extension project is directly related to whether the use of the road can meet the requirements after the completion of the project. Excessive settlement differences can lead to pavement cracking and even subgrade instability and collapse. Therefore, it is very necessary to monitor the settlement of the reconstruction and extension project in order to control the construction. This paper aims at the uneven settlement caused by the different consolidation degree of the foundation in the widening roadbed and the uneven settlement caused by the different compression degree of the roadbed. The settlement mechanism is studied in theory. According to the engineering situation, this paper makes some meaningful research on the settlement control standard of the new widening roadbed in the reconstruction and extension project of this project. According to the measured data in construction and the data obtained from the finite element simulation calculation, the settlement control standard of the new widening roadbed is checked and analyzed. The selected control standards and control methods are verified from the actual engineering. After the settlement data of different working conditions and different construction periods are obtained, The measured data obtained in settlement monitoring can be fitted by mathematical method, and the variation trend of subgrade settlement in a period in the future can be calculated, and the later settlement change can be predicted by fitting curves. In order to ensure the construction quality of widening roadbed, the corresponding reasonable construction control measures can be taken for the future construction through the predicted results.
